This new tweak lets jailbreakers colorize iOS’ scrollbars

A component of iOS that you probably see rather frequently when you use the Settings app or other scrollable interfaces is the scrollbar that appears at the right side of the display to give you an idea of where you are on the page.

The scrollbar does a great job of being both a reference point and a means of scrolling up or down a page much more quickly, but it’s lacking something: customization. That’s where a newly released jailbreak tweak called Color My Scrolls by iOS developer TheLazyITGuy comes into play.

When Microsoft acquired the to-do list application Wunderlist in 2015, no one knew for sure how long it would keep the popular task app alive. Even after an announcement in 2017 that it would discontinue Wunderlist in favor of Microsoft To-Do, the app was still usable. But that has finally come to an end.

As of May 6, 2020, Wunderlist will finally close its virtual doors to users.

If you’re a fan of Wunderlist and have been using it for years, it’s time to grab your tasks and move on, if you haven’t already. Here’s how to export, email, or print your to-dos from Wunderlist.
